To calculate the monthly payment needed to pay off a credit card balance in a given time period, we can use the formula for fixed monthly payment:

Monthly Payment = P * (r * (1+r)^n) / ((1+r)^n - 1)

Where:

  • P is the initial balance
  • r is the monthly interest rate (APR divided by 12)
  • n is the total number of payments (months)
